I don't necessarily believe it should be banned but I do think that more options for not wealthy
children should be available. Private schools do have a better curriculum but this is because the
teachers are better trained and get paid more. I think if the school systems had more money and the
teachers got paid the same as private schools, public schools would be equivalent. Instead, here in
America, we pay our athletes and actors/actresses millions of dollars while teachers make pennies.
The system is all backwards and I think it is ridiculous that people think this is OK. If that money
was invested in public schools, there would not be much difference between the two. |
